Research. My primary research interest is on natural language processing, with an emphasis on representation learning. My research seeks to avail modern NLP applications in a broad spectrum of languages and domains. In collaboration with my advisor, fellow professors, and graduate/undergraduate researchers, I have proposed a series of new representation learning techniques to solve significant problems, such as embedding universal language syntax and transferring representations across languages and domains. The proposed models have been applied to a wide range of NLP applications, including text classification, question answering, semantic parsing, etc. My research also expands to other areas such as privacy-preserving personalized web search, users' intent modeling in web search, and keyphrase generation for contextual targeting. I have so far authored and co-authored 13 published research papers on these topics during my Ph.D. study. In the future, I plan to further explore semi-supervised, unsupervised, and transfer learning techniques to facilitate NLP from limited labeled data.
